로컬 LLM이 코드 생성에서 계속 실패하는 이유 (그리고 해결 방법)

드디어 고사양 GPU에서 34B 파라미터 모델을 돌리기 시작했습니다. 프롬프트를 입력하면 완벽해 보이는 함수를 자신만만하게 작성하지만, 막상 알고 보면 존재하지 않는 API를 호출하고 있습니다. 이런 경험 있으시죠? 저는 3개월 가까이 로컬 LLM을 주력 개발 보조 도구로 만들고자 했고, 그 과정에서 수없이 많은 환각, 추론 오류, 성능 함정을 겪었습니다. 이 글에서는 실제 실험에서 얻은 핵심 교훈을 정리합니다: 올바른 양자화 선택, 효과적인 프롬프트 전략 수립, 코드 수준 검증 도입, 그리고 단일 모델로 감당할 수 없는 부분을 보완할 하이브리드 접근법.

배경

드디어 고사양 GPU에서 34B 파라미터 규모의 대형 언어 모델을 구동하기 시작했습니다. 복잡한 프롬프트를 입력하면 모델은 자신만만하게 완벽해 보이는 함수 코드를 생성해냅니다. 하지만 막상 실행해보거나 코드를 자세히 살펴보면, 존재하지 않는 API를 호출하고 있거나 문법적으로 유효하지 않은 구조를 가지고 있는 것을 발견하게 됩니다. 이러한 경험은 로컬 LLM을 실제 개발 워크플로우에 통합하려는 개발자들에게 매우 익숙한 상황일 것입니다.

저는 지난 3개월간 로컬 LLM을 일상적인 개발의 주력 보조 도구로 만들기 위해 수많은 시도를 해왔습니다. 그 과정에서 수없이 많은 환각(Hallucination), 추론 과정의 붕괴, 그리고 예상치 못한 성능 함정을 겪었습니다. 이 기간 동안 얻은 핵심 교훈은 단순히 모델을 돌리는 것을 넘어, 올바른 양자화(Quantization) 방식을 선택하고, 효과적인 프롬프트 엔지니어링 전략을 수립하며, 코드 수준의 검증을 도입하는 것이 얼마나 중요한지를 일깨워주었습니다. 또한 단일 모델의 한계를 보완하기 위한 하이브리드 접근법의 필요성을 절감했습니다.

2026년 1분기, AI 산업은 급속도로 진화하고 있습니다. Dev.to AI를 비롯한 주요 매체들의 보도에 따르면, 로컬 모델의 코드 생성 한계에 대한 논의는 소셜 미디어와 업계 포럼에서 뜨거운 감자로 떠올랐습니다. 이는 단순한 기술적 불만을 넘어, AI 산업이 '기술 돌파기'에서 '대규모 상용화기'로 전환하는 과정에서의 구조적 변화를 반영하는 신호로 해석됩니다.

심층 분석

로컬 LLM의 코드 생성 실패 원인을 이해하기 위해서는 기술적, 상업적, 생태계적 차원에서 다각도로 접근해야 합니다. 기술적 관점에서 보면, 2026년의 AI 기술은 더 이상 단일 모델의 성능 경쟁이 아닌 시스템 공학의 시대입니다. 데이터 수집부터 모델 훈련, 추론 최적화, 그리고 배포 및 운영에 이르기까지 각 단계마다 전문화된 도구와 팀이 필요해졌으며, 로컬 환경에서의 제약은 이러한 시스템적 결함을 더욱 부각시킵니다.

상업적 관점에서는 AI 산업이 '기술 주도'에서 '수요 주도'로 빠르게 이동하고 있습니다. 기업들은 단순한 기술 데모나 개념 증명(POC)에 만족하지 않습니다. 그들은 명확한 투자수익률(ROI), 측정 가능한 비즈니스 가치, 그리고 신뢰할 수 있는 서비스 수준 계약(SLA)을 요구합니다. 로컬 모델의 코드 생성 오류는 이러한 엄격한 비즈니스 요구사항을 충족시키지 못하는 주요 장애물로 작용하며, 이는 모델 선택 기준을 근본적으로 바꾸고 있습니다.

생태계 차원에서는 경쟁의 초점이 단일 제품에서 전체 생태계로 이동하고 있습니다. 모델 자체의 성능뿐만 아니라, 이를 지원하는 도구 체인, 활발한 개발자 커뮤니티, 그리고 특정 산업에 맞는 솔루션을 제공할 수 있는지가 장기적인 경쟁 우위를 결정합니다. 로컬 모델의 성공 여부는 결국 이 생태계 내에서 얼마나 잘 통합되고 검증되느냐에 달려 있습니다.

2026년 1분기 관련 데이터는 이러한 추세를 명확히 보여줍니다. AI 인프라 투자는 전년 동기 대비 200% 이상 증가했으며, 기업의 AI 도입률은 2025년의 35%에서 약 50%로 상승했습니다. 특히 주목할 만한 점은 AI 보안 관련 투자가 전체의 15%를 돌파했으며, 배포 기준에서 오픈소스 모델의 기업 채택률이 클로즈드소스 모델을 처음으로 앞지렀다는 사실입니다. 이는 로컬 및 오픈소스 모델이 단순한 실험용이 아닌, 핵심 인프라로 자리 잡고 있음을 의미합니다.

산업 영향

로컬 LLM의 코드 생성 한계와 이를 해결하려는 노력은 AI 생태계 전반에 파급 효과를 일으키고 있습니다. 이 영향은 직접적인 관련 당사자를 넘어, 공급망의 상류와 하류, 그리고 인력 시장까지 광범위하게 미치고 있습니다.

상류 공급망 측면에서, AI 인프라(컴퓨팅 파워, 데이터, 개발 도구) 제공자들은 수요 구조의 변화를 겪고 있습니다. 특히 GPU 공급이 여전히 긴박한 상황에서, 로컬 모델의 효율적인 추론을 위한 최적화 기술에 대한 수요가 증가하면서 컴퓨팅 자원의 배분 우선순위가 재조정되고 있습니다. 저전력 고효율 추론을 위한 양자화 기술과 같은 니치 시장의 성장이 예상됩니다.

하류 개발자 및 최종 사용자 관점에서는 사용 가능한 도구와 서비스의 선택지가 빠르게 변화하고 있습니다. '백모대전(수많은 모델이 경쟁하는 상황)' 속에서 개발자들은 단순한 벤치마크 점수뿐만 아니라 벤더의 장기적인 생존 가능성과 생태계의 건강성을 고려해야 합니다. 이는 개발자의 기술 스택 선택에 더 많은 전략적 판단을 요구합니다.

인재 시장에서도 변화가 감지됩니다. 로컬 모델 최적화, 프롬프트 엔지니어링, 코드 검증 자동화 등 특정 분야에 대한 수요가 급증하면서, 관련 분야의顶级 연구원과 엔지니어들이 각 기업 간 경쟁의 핵심 자원으로 부상하고 있습니다. 인재의 흐름은 곧 산업의 미래 방향성을 가리키는 나침반이 되고 있습니다.

특히 중국 AI 시장의 움직임은 주목할 만합니다. DeepSeek, 퉁이치엔원(Qwen), Kimi 등 중국산 모델들은 낮은 비용, 빠른 반복 속도, 그리고 현지 시장 요구에 밀접한 제품 전략을 통해 글로벌 AI 시장의 구도를 바꾸고 있습니다. 이는 로컬 LLM 생태계가 지역별로 차별화된 경로를 걷고 있음을 보여주며, 글로벌 경쟁 구도에 새로운 변수를 추가하고 있습니다.

전망

단기적으로(3~6개월), 경쟁사들의 빠른 대응이 예상됩니다. AI 산업에서는 주요 기술적 논의나 제품 발표가 수주 내에 경쟁사의 대응을 촉발합니다. 로컬 모델의 코드 생성 품질 개선과 관련된 새로운 양자화 기법이나 프롬프트 템플릿이 빠르게 출회될 것이며, 개발자 커뮤니티의 평가와 채택 속도가 해당 기술의 실제 영향력을 결정할 것입니다. 또한 관련 섹터의 투자 시장에서는 가치 재평가 현상이 나타날 수 있습니다.

장기적으로(12~18개월), 이 현상은 다음과 같은 거시적 트렌드의 촉매제 역할을 할 것입니다. 첫째, 모델 간 성능 격차가 좁아지면서 AI 능력이 상품화(AI capability commoditization)되는 속도가 가속화될 것입니다. 순수한 모델 성능만으로는 지속 가능한 경쟁 우위가 되기 어렵습니다. 둘째, 수직 산업별 AI 심화(VERTICAL AI)가 진행됩니다. 범용 AI 플랫폼은 특정 산업의 노하우(Know-how)를 깊이 이해한 솔루션에 밀릴 것이며, 도메인 특화 모델의 가치가 높아질 것입니다. 셋째, AI 네이티브 워크플로우의 재설계가 이루어집니다. 기존 프로세스에 AI를 결합하는 것을 넘어, AI의 능력을 중심으로 한 새로운 업무 프로세스가 정립될 것입니다.

넷째, 지역별 AI 생태계의 분화가 심화됩니다. 각 지역은 자체적인 규제 환경, 인력 풀, 산업 기반에 따라 서로 다른 특성을 가진 AI 생태계를 발전시킬 것입니다. 이러한 추세를 주시하기 위해서는 주요 AI 기업의 제품 출시 리듬과 가격 정책 변화, 오픈소스 커뮤니티의 재현 및 개선 속도, 규제 기관의 정책 방향, 그리고 기업 고객의 실제 채택률과 이탈률 데이터를 지속적으로 모니터링해야 합니다. 이러한 신호들은 로컬 LLM이 코드 생성에서 실패하는 문제를 어떻게 해결해 나갈지, 그리고 AI 산업이 다음 단계로 어떻게 진화할지를 판단하는 핵심 기준이 될 것입니다.